Star Trek: Discovery, set about 10 years before the events of the original Star Trek series, follows the story of Michael Burnham, a half-human, half-Vulcan who becomes the first officer of the USS Shenzhou and later, the USS Discovery. The series explores themes of identity, loyalty, and redemption as Burnham navigates the complexities of being a mixed-heritage officer in a predominantly human-dominated fleet.
